Step-by-Step Cup Pressing Guide

Pressing a cup using the cup heat press machine is a straightforward process that requires attention to detail and precision. With the right settings and techniques, you can achieve smooth and even results. In this section, we will walk you through the step-by-step process of pressing a cup using the machine.

Safety Precautions

Before starting the cup pressing process, it’s essential to ensure that you follow proper safety precautions. This includes wearing heat-resistant gloves and protective eyewear when handling the machine and its parts. Additionally, make sure the area around the machine is clear of flammable materials.

  1. Turn on the machine and preheat it to the ideal temperature, usually between 302°F (150°C) and 392°F (200°C), depending on the material of the cup.
  2. Place a cup on the heat press machine’s platen, ensuring it’s centered and evenly positioned for optimal heat distribution.
  3. Close the heat press lid and press the start button.
  4. Set the machine to run for the recommended time, typically 30 seconds to 1 minute, depending on the specific cup and heat press settings.
  5. After the machine signals that it’s complete, carefully lift the heat press lid and remove the cup.
  6. Allow the cup to cool before handling it or applying any finishes.

Pressure Problems

Pressure is critical in achieving high-quality prints on cups. However, pressure issues can occur due to various reasons such as uneven pressure distribution, low pressure settings, or improper placement of the cup. Some common problems and their solutions are as follows:

  • Uneven pressure distribution: This can be caused by uneven surface pressure or a poorly designed pad. To resolve this issue, ensure that the pad is designed for even pressure distribution and that the surface pressure is uniform.
  • Low pressure settings: Check that the pressure settings are within the recommended range for your specific machine. If the pressure is too low, increase the pressure setting to achieve optimal results.
  • Improper placement of the cup: Place the cup correctly in the machine’s mold, ensuring that it is centered and aligned with the pressure source.

Temperature Problems

Temperature is another critical factor in achieving high-quality prints. Incorrect temperature settings or malfunctioning temperature control can lead to poor results or damaged machines. Some common temperature-related problems and their solutions are as follows:

  • Incorrect temperature settings: Check that the temperature settings are within the recommended range for your specific machine and the type of ink or material being used.
  • Malfunctioning temperature control: Ensure that the temperature control unit is functioning correctly and that the temperature sensors are accurate.
